Two China-linked APT clusters (including Mustang Panda) have been observed targeting ASEAN-affiliated entities with spear-phishing and DLL sideloading to deploy PUBLOAD/PlugX and related backdoors, while Trend Micro attributes widespread targeting by a China-focused actor called Earth Krahang that exploits public-facing Openfire/Oracle server flaws and spear-phishing to deliver PlugX, ShadowPad, ReShell, and DinodasRAT. Separately, leaked I-Soon documents reveal an integrated hack-for-hire capability—selling stealers, RATs, and operational platforms and showing operational ties between the contractor and multiple state-aligned groups—illustrating a sophisticated, outsourced Chinese cyber-espionage ecosystem.
